What is Amazon FBA

When offering a product on Amazon, vendors have 3 alternatives when it comes to purchasing fulfillment. They can select to load and ship the product themselves (Fulfillment-by-Merchant and Seller Fulfilled Prime), or they can select to outsource delivery, product packaging, and storage to Amazon using FBA.

How does it work?

When creating a product listing or putting up a item for sale on Amazon, sellers have to decide their fulfillment method. Sellers can change between gratification techniques whenever they need to.

The FBA procedure is easy.

  1. Vendors procure the products and ship them to an Amazon storehouse. Amazon will give you the needed contact details as well as address.
  2. The products are after that stored at Amazon’s fulfillment center until an order is placed by a customer. There is a storage cost, mainly relying on the size/volume of the product.
  3. Once an order is placed, Amazon takes care of the deal as well as updates your inventory.
  4. The order is jam-packed as well as delivered by Amazon.
  5. The on-line retail titan deals with consumer care as well as follows up on the order. Returns as well as refunds are likewise managed by Amazon.
  6. Every two weeks, Amazon sends you the benefit from your sales.

Keep in mind: Sellers require to guarantee that their shipments to Amazon satisfaction centers comply with the on-line retail giant’s stringent packaging guidelines.

Amazon FBA inventory fees explained

Among the greatest perks that include FBA is stock monitoring and storage. If they are utilizing the solution, Amazon sellers will certainly not need to spend large amounts of capital upfront for storage area. As I’ve pointed out previously, this does come with a nominal price. Amazon bills a month-to-month cost for all inventory in its satisfaction facilities. The fee is based on volume and also depends on the size of the product and the moment of the year at which it is stored. Storage fees are treked throughout the holiday season (October to December).

For products in the US, Amazon regular monthly storage space charges are charged between the 7th and also 15th day of the month complying with the month for which the charge applies. This indicates that your storage fee for March will certainly be billed between the 7th and 15th of April.

Regular monthly storage cost for non-dangerous goods:

MonthStandard-sizeOversize
January– September$ 0.75 per cubic foot$ 0.48 per cubic foot
October– December$ 2.40 per cubic foot$ 1.20 per cubic foot

Note: Dangerous goods call for special handling as well as storage. The storage charge is higher. You can find out more regarding unsafe products on vendor central.

Aside from monthly storage costs, if your product has been stored at a fulfillment facility for over a year, it is reliant be billed long-lasting storage space charges. For items stored for over a year, Amazon bills the seller a fee of $6.90 per cubic foot of storage space made use of, or $0.15 per product (whichever is higher). This fee is subtracted every month. This can swiftly include up if you’re not mindful, so it is essential to keep track of your stock at Amazon’s fulfillment. If product turnover is low, it can drastically impact your productivity with FBA.

Note: To keep an eye on stock, FBA vendors can use the Inventory Health record.

Logistics assistance and scalability

This is without a doubt the very best thing about Amazon FBA. Given that Amazon takes care of the delivery and storage space of the item, you can conserve a great deal of cash on storage and also easily range your business. You do not need to invest a lot of cash upfront to work with storage area.

If your company is kicking-off, and you’re offering more than ever, Amazon will look after the extra shipping duties. All you require to do is ensure you replace your supply.

Fast as well as cost-free delivery with Amazon Prime

Amazon has irrevocably changed the way we buy points. With the intro of Amazon Prime, consumers expect lightning-fast distribution every time. Amazon FBA vendors automatically receive Prime. Thanks to the countless Amazon satisfaction centers worldwide, your products can be provided within a couple of days.

Non-FBA sellers can opt-in for Seller Fulfilled Prime (SFP), but sellers need to qualify to be eligible. This calls for a clean sales background as well as vendor comments. You’ll additionally need a expert account to apply for SFP.

The Buy Box advantage

If you have a expert vendor account and also market a product making use of Amazon FBA, you are more likely to win the Buy Box. Why is this important? More than 80% of Amazon’s sales are from the innocuous yellow button on a item listing. Winning the Buy Box usually causes a massive boost to your sales.

Discounted delivery rates

Amazon is the undeniable king of ecommerce. Amazon’s broad logistics network also provides clients the best offer when it comes to shipping prices– often also complimentary shipping with Prime.

Customer support

If you’re an FBA seller, Amazon will be the point of get in touch with for your consumers. This implies Amazon’s 24/7 client assistance manages returns and customer questions. There is a processing cost involved when it comes to returns, yet it’s typically worth it.

Amazon FBA: Disadvantages

Now that I have waxed eloquently regarding Amazon FBA, it is time to move on to several of its negative aspects.

It’s not complimentary

The problem develops due to Amazon’s storage space charges. You can remove stock from Amazon storage facilities, yet that isn’t always totally free.

FBA is best if your online service sells little products with high turn over (high-volume vendors.) It could be far better to deliver the plans on your own if you’re preparing on selling a huge item with reduced turn over. You can make use of SellerApp’s convenient FBA profit calculator to examine a product’s earnings.

Supply monitoring

It can be challenging to track your stock and what items you have readily available when you’re not directly entailed in the sales process. If your product is out of supply, Amazon will minimize its product ranking as well as exposure.

Sending inventory to Amazon isn’t easy either. You can send the items yourself, work with a middle-man to do it, or have your supplier ship the products directly to gratification facilities. Amazon is incredibly strict concerning its packaging and labeling guidelines. The on-line retail giant might return the products if you do not adhere to the standards. If you’re uncertain about Amazon packaging, it is always a excellent concept to contact logistics solutions that can help you out at the start of your seller trip.

Minimal branding

Given that Amazon packs and also ships your product from its fulfillment facilities, you are missing out on a branding possibility. While you have control over your product packaging, the shipping boxes will certainly constantly have Amazon’s logo design as well as brand name. If you’re looking to create a brand and also personalize the client experience, your options are restricted with FBA.

Should your company use Amazon FBA?

This is a tricky concern to answer. As a whole, vendors need to consider making use of FBA if they are selling little products with high turnover. This limits storage costs and guarantees that they’ll never be subject to lasting storage prices.

The crucial point to keep in mind is that satisfaction approaches can differ from product to product. The exact same vendor can make use of FBA for children’s playthings and also select FBM for a huge table. This is why lots of vendors use both FBA and self-fulfillment methods to make the most out of the Amazon Marketplace.

Another aspect you should take into consideration is combining.

Imitation and mislabeled items are a large problem in the online marketplace. Without physical confirmation of products, lots of imitation products slip with fractures and get to consumers. This can come back to cost an straightforward seller if they are offering the very same item and also have actually allowed commingling.

So, what is combining?

It is a satisfaction choice readily available to FBA sellers where Amazon assembles items from different vendors for handling and also delivery. It mixes products with the very same maker ID from various sellers or brand names selling on Amazon. This typical swimming pool of items is after that used to fulfill consumer orders. This means when an order for Seller A’s device of inventory gets here, it might be fulfilled by any kind of the same item Amazon has on hand– from any seller. It will directly hurt your track record if your competitor or a unethical seller is sending out damaged or phony versions of your commingled products. This can be devastating for legit organizations and can lead to lots of unhappy consumers.

Combining is not all negative. It does make it less complicated for sellers to send out items to Amazon’s storage facility. You will certainly have to individually classify each product that you send out to Amazon if you’re not combining your products.

The commingled inventory choice, on the other hand, enables merchants to minimize time and also labor costs. It does not need private labels but instead uses a bar code to group products together. Not all products can be combined, but if fraudulence and imitation products are not a concern, it could be a method to save time and money.

Fortunately, you have the power to determine whether you intend to combine your product. Here’s just how you can change your commingling setups:

  1. Browse to ‘Settings’ on your vendor central account
  2. Select ‘Fulfillment by Amazon’
  3. Scroll down the web page and look for ‘FBA item barcode preference’
  4. Modify ‘Amazon barcode’ to get rid of commingling

You can make a decision to classify the products yourself if you pick not to combine your products. You can additionally allow Amazon do it for you, but they do charge you for the service.
